Spartanburg, S.C. – The Wofford women’s team had an early lead but could not close out Davidson on Wednesday afternoon at the Reeves Tennis Center. Davidson went on to win the match 6-1. The loss ends the Terriers tough 2010 season with a record of 1-21 and 0-10 in the Southern Conference. Davidson improves to 14-6 and 6-2 in the Southern Conference.
For the first time all season the Terriers won the doubles point to take a key 1-0 advantage. Stephanie Cox and Sonia Anand got things started for Wofford by winning their number three doubles match against Ail Gores and Samantha Galainena 8-6.
Haley Baird and Guinn Garcia clinched the doubles point with a gutsy victory at number one doubles over Virginia Berry and Teresa Wang. The match went back and forth for over an hour before a tie breaker was needed to break the 8-8 tie. Baird and Garcia won the tie breaker 8-6 to give Wofford a 9-8 victory.
In singles action Davidson rallied and swept all six singles matches on their way to a 6-1 victory.
